#025206 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#025206 is composed of 0.8% red, 32.2% green and 2.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 97.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 92.7% yellow and 67.8% black. It has a hue angle of 123 degrees, a saturation of 95.2% and a lightness of 16.5%. #025206 color hex could be obtained by blending #04a40c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006600.

Shades and Tints of #025206

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000500 is the darkest color, while #f1fff2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#025206

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#292b29 is the less saturated color, while #025206 is the most saturated one.
